How Do You Know if a Wisdom Tooth Is Infected?

WebThe first sign of an infected wisdom tooth is usually pain at the back of your mouth, either in or around the wisdom tooth or in the jaw. If it’s not immediately treated, the pain might spread into the throat and neck as well as all over the jaw. You might also have a sore throat, and the lymph glands just under the jaw may become swollen as ... WebIsolated uvulitis is a rarely reported disease. Known etiologies include bacterial infection and trauma following the use of instrumentation in the airway. Three cases of isolated uvulitis secondary to heavy marijuana smoke inhalation are reported. Specific recommendations regarding diagnosis and tr …
